Firefox/Planning/2011-07-06

From MozillaWiki
Jump to: navigation, search
« previous week | index | next week »

Planning Meeting Details

  • Wednesdays - 11:00am PDT, 18:00 UTC
  • Mountain View Offices: Warp Core Conference Room
  • Toronto Offices: Fin du Monde Conference Room
  • 650-903-0800 or 650-215-1282 x92 Conf# 8605 (US/INTL)
  • 1-800-707-2533 (pin 369) Conf# 8605 (US)
  • irc.mozilla.org #planning for backchannel
  • (the developer meeting takes place on Tuesdays)
REMEMBER
These notes are read by people who weren't able to attend the meeting. Please make sure to include links and context so they can be understood.


Actions from Last Week

None!

Schedule & Progress on Upcoming Releases

Firefox Desktop

Release (3.6, 4.0, 5.0)

  • Talking about creating a 5.0.1 for a 10.7 crasher bug 663688. The issue is in Apple's 10.7 GM code (to be released in July, probably soon) and we have 2 ways to work around:
    1. Turn off downloadable fonts for users on 10.7
    2. Switch font rendering frameworks for users on 10.7 (ATS → CGFont)
  • Aurora and Beta are not affected as we took the font rendering framework change there
  • Deciding what to do for release by tomorrow
  • Ideally would like to release the 5.0.1 update only to Mac users

Beta (6)

Aurora (7)

Nightly (8)

  • Didn't close the tree during the source code migration, mozilla-central is chugging along nicely

Firefox Mobile

5

Firefox 5 launched two weeks ago (sim-ship with desktop)

6

Went to build yesterday (July 5), currently in QA. Will publish as BETA to Android Market as soon as we get QA sign-off - tonight or tomorrow - sim-ship with desktop (see Release Schedule). This will update Beta in Android Market, bridging the current gap (official release is newer than the current Firefox 5 Beta)

New features in 6:

  • Better first-run experience - guide showing Browser Tools and features, faster start using less memory
  • Higher-quality image scaling (on devices with NEON-compatible processors).[When zoomed in our out, less pixelation, crisper display of logos, etc.]
  • Improvements for large-screen tablets [Optimizing Firefox for larger tablet devices, e.g. by adjusting UI elements, buttons, font size. (Phase 1)]
  • Improved Form Helper [Form helper is less obtrusive on Android now]
  • Theme changes for phones running Android 2.3 (Gingerbread) [Now refreshed to look even more beautiful on Gingerbread OS.]
  • Fixed bugs: Optimized rendering of pages that use RTL layout (languages like Arabic, Hebrew) [Universal access]
  • Touch Events (part 1 - single touch only). [Expose touch events to content for better interaction with web pages and services, and compatibility with WebKit/Opera and existing web content.]
  • IndexedDB database storage for web pages. [Pick up where you left off (e.g after crash or when terminated in the background (adding session history. Currently only saves last URL), better performance and memory management]
  • Automatic text hyphenation with the -moz-hyphens CSS property (bug 253317).

7

moved to AURORA yesterday, July 5, 2011 (see Release Schedule)

Some new items:

  • Selecting text in web content
  • Locale selection during firstrun
  • Publish in Android Market?

8

moved to NIGHTLY yesterday, July 5, 2011

Some new items:

  • Tablet UI
  • Pull locales from AMO
  • Basic webapp support
  • Use doorhangers?

Firefox Sync

  • Beta (6) - Sync Discovery
  • Aurora (7) - Instant Sync
  • Firefox Sync Add-on EOL Plan - Phase 1
  • Next major feature is Improving Sync Set Up
    • Nailing down requirements
    • Doing User Research for Mobile Sync Set up

Add-on Builder Beta!

Add-on SDK 1.1

Input 4.3

  • ETA: 7/14
    • Complications occurred on 4.2 release with Elastic Search and metrics production clusters, so had it disabled. Looking to have it up in the next release.
    • Grouperfish will land in 4.3.

Feedback Summary

  • Addon Compatibility: Google Toolbar, Roboform, Tiddlysnip
  • Website Compatibility: Bitdefender scanner, FAFSA

Press & Public Reactions

Questions, Comments and Highlights

Actions this week